ibkr-mcp
ibkr-mcp is a read-only MCP server for Interactive Brokers IBKR Gateway or TWS. It connects to an already running socket API session and exposes account, contract, execution, and historical-data queries to MCP clients over stdio.
The server does not implement any order-entry operations. There are no tools for placing, modifying, or cancelling orders.
What It Exposes
| Tool | Purpose | | --- | --- | | ibkr_status | Confirm connectivity and return IBKR server time. | | ibkr_accounts | List managed accounts visible to the current login. | | ibkr_account_summary | Fetch account summary values such as cash, buying power, and margin. | | ibkr_positions | List open positions across accessible accounts. | | ibkr_open_orders | List currently open orders visible to the session. | | ibkr_executions | Fetch execution reports with optional account, symbol, side, and time filters. | | ibkr_search_contracts | Search contracts by ticker or company name. | | ibkr_contract_details | Resolve a partial contract definition into concrete IBKR contract details. | | ibkr_historical_bars | Fetch read-only historical bars for a contract. |
Safety Model
- Every registered MCP tool is read-only.
- The server never calls IBKR APIs for order placement, modification, or cancellation.
- A local process lock prevents duplicate
ibkr-mcpinstances from starting against the sameIBKR_HOST/IBKR_PORT/IBKR_CLIENT_IDcombination. - You should still enable IBKR's own
Read-Only APIsetting if you want Gateway- or TWS-level enforcement as a second guardrail.
Prerequisites
- Node.js and npm
- A running IBKR Gateway or TWS session
- Socket API access enabled in that IBKR session
In IBKR Gateway or TWS:
- Open the API settings page.
- Enable
ActiveX and Socket Clients. - Set the socket port to the value you want this server to use.
- Enable
Read-Only APIif you want IBKR to enforce read-only access too. - Allow
127.0.0.1or your MCP host in trusted IPs if your IBKR configuration requires it.
The server default is IBKR_PORT=4002, which matches the common IBKR Gateway paper-trading setup. If your session uses a different port, set IBKR_PORT explicitly.

IBKR_CLIENT_ID must be unique for the API client session you want to open. Run exactly one ibkr-mcp process per IBKR_HOST / IBKR_PORT / IBKR_CLIENT_ID.
If your MCP client launches this server for you, do not also leave a separate npm start process running against the same target. The server will fail fast if another instance already holds the same lock.
Configuration
| Variable | Default | Description | | --- | --- | --- | | IBKR_HOST | 127.0.0.1 | Hostname of the IBKR Gateway or TWS socket API endpoint. | | IBKR_PORT | 4002 | Socket API port. | | IBKR_CLIENT_ID | 19191 | API client ID used when connecting to IBKR. | | IBKR_TIMEOUT_MS | 10000 | Request timeout for IBKR API calls. | | IBKR_ACCOUNT_GROUP | All | Default account group for ibkr_account_summary. | | IBKR_ACCOUNT_SUMMARY_TAGS | conservative defaults | Optional comma-separated override for summary fields. |
Default account summary tags:
AccountType,NetLiquidation,TotalCashValue,SettledCash,BuyingPower,AvailableFunds,ExcessLiquidity,GrossPositionValue,InitMarginReq,MaintMarginReq,DayTradesRemaining

This project uses stdio transport. That means each MCP client normally starts its own server process. If you need multiple clients to share one IBKR session, move to a shared daemon or network transport rather than launching separate stdio instances.
Usage Notes
ibkr_executionsaccepts eithertimein raw IB format (YYYYMMDD HH:mm:ss) orsincein RFC3339 form, but not both.ibkr_search_contractsis useful for discovery;ibkr_contract_detailsis the better follow-up when you need a specific contract definition for downstream calls.- For stock and option lookups, the server infers
SMARTas the default exchange when appropriate. For cash pairs, it infersIDEALPRO. - Historical data, executions, and some contract lookups still depend on the permissions attached to the logged-in IBKR user.
Troubleshooting
- Connection failures usually mean the IBKR session is not running, the socket API is disabled, the port is wrong, or the client ID is already in use.
- Duplicate-process errors mean another
ibkr-mcpprocess is already running with the same host, port, and client ID combination. - Empty or incomplete market-data responses often point to IBKR permissions, exchange entitlements, or an underspecified contract.
- This server does not launch IBKR Gateway or TWS. It only connects to an existing API endpoint.
